Self-isolation rules for students
While in self-isolation, a resident is prohibited from accessing or using common areas or shared residence facilities, including (but not limited to) laundry rooms, front desk, fitness rooms, study spaces and the kitchen. Individuals entering self-isolation accommodation (E.g. to retrieve groceries or meals) must wash their hands immediately before doing so, and wear a facemask at all times, maintain a safe distance and avoid physical contact with others

Covid-19 quarantine and isolation
5 days self-isolation is mandatory for infected or positive cases as per guidelines of the Ministry of Health (Estijaba/DOH)
Close contacts are not required to isolate anymore, but test on the first day only
Are available and equipped in compliance with relevant government guidelines. We have isolation rooms in the clinic, residences, and the sport buildings
NB: Above information may be changed or updated on regular basis as per latest updates and Covid-19 quarantine and isolation guidance from DOH, NCEMA and other regulatory authorities.
